Our architecture is based on silicon photonics which gives us the ability to produce our components at Tier-1 semiconductor fabs such as GlobalFoundries where we leverage high-volume semiconductor manufacturing processes, the same processes that are already producing billions of chips for telecom and consumer electronics applications. We also benefit from the quantum mechanics reality that photons don't feel heat or electromagnetic interference, allowing us to take advantage of existing cryogenic cooling systems and industry standard fiber connectivity.

Job Summary:
The test automation engineer will be responsible for developing and implementing the software, methods and test infrastructure required by standard test flows for various electrical, optical and electro-optical subsystems.
Responsibilities:
Leading a complex, high speed electro-optical test station project which includes definition of requirements, equipment sourcing, station assembly, and testing and validation of the finished system.Review of sub-system designs including integration of optics, electronics, firmware, software and thermal design.Designing and building laboratory setups comprised of light sources, detectors, switches function generators, oscilloscopes, etc.Developing SW scripts to automatically drive the measurements setups and feed data into a database.Developing SW and algorithms to perform data analysis and extract key performance parameters.Developing test plans, standard tests procedures and automated test flows.Transferring test procedures and instructions to lab operators.Experience/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in engineering or physical science with 6+ years of industry experience.Experience in the design and testing of high-speed electro-optical sub-systems such as line cards used in telecommunications equipment or similar.Able to drive the sourcing and testing of test equipment, optical assemblies, and electronics.Proficiency in Python, including the principles of object-oriented programming, for automating data collection and data analysis.Experience developing test methods such as tuning/calibration algorithms.Experience with interfacing and automating optical hardware test equipment, including power meters, optical backscatter reflectometers (OBR), optical spectrum analyzers (OSA), oscilloscopes, function generators (AWG), and vector network analyzers (VNA).Technical project management experience preferred.Experience with manufacturing execution system (MES) and SQL is preferred.PsiQuantum provides equal employment opportunity for all applicants and employees.
